Why review_element_prereview_results_get is rated Low
This tool retrieves pre-review results for ad elements—purely a data lookup operation. No side effects, no modifications, no code execution, no financial impact. Categorized as Read with low severity because even if an AI misuses it by querying inappropriate elements, the worst outcome is information disclosure about review status, which has minimal blast radius.
From the tool's definition Tool name contains 'get' and 'query' (查询 = query); description translates to 'query pre-review results of elements'. Returns review/approval status data without modifying or executing anything.

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the review_element_prereview_results_get r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.
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for review_element_prereview_results_get.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
